HIV status in Nepal till 2005: Total Adult=70000, Adult Prevalence (15-49)=0.55%, Number of Women (15-49) LWHA=15,310 (22%), HIV Prevalence rate in IDUs=32.7%, HIV prevalence rate in sex worker=3.8%, HIV prevalence rate in client of SW=2.1%. The latest U.N. report shows that 65 million people have been infected with HIV since it was first identified 25 years ago. Twenty five million people have died of AIDS.

  1. Aspirin- a'si pi lin
  2. Albendazole- a' ben da zuo
  3. Amoxicillin- a'mo xi lin
  4. Antibiotic- kang sheng su
  5. Antiseptic- sha jun ji
  6. Glucose- pu tao tang
  7. Iodine- dian jiu
  8. Insulin- yi dao su
  9. Vitamin- wei sheng su
  10. Vaseline- fan shi lin
  11. Painkiller- zhi tong yao
  12. Protein- dan bai zhi

SOME MORE ENGLISH-CHINESE DRUGS LIST:
  1. Atenolol- a'ti luo er
  2. Atropine- a'tuo pin
  3. Ciprofloxacin- huan bing sha xing
  4. Diazepam- de xi pan
  5. Dopamine- duo ba an
  6. Metronidazole- jia xiao da zuo
  7. Paracetamol- dui yi xian an ji fen
  8. Penicillin (G/V)- qing mei su (G/V)
